BOFA partners with Photocentric to enhance customer proposition

Leading 3D printing filtration specialists BOFA is partnering with Photocentric, an innovator in photopolymer 3D printing technology, to provide extraction systems to the company’s growing customer base.

Photocentric now recommends BOFA’s established line-up of specialist extraction units to help remove smells and potentially hazardous fumes from 3D print processes, thereby contributing to a safe and healthy working environment.

The partnership builds on a relationship first established two years ago and follows a successful internal Photocentric test programme and extended trials at user sites.

BOFA’s 3D PrintPRO 3 technology has been approved for use with Photocentric’s LC Magna 3D printer and Air Wash L washing station, while the 3D PrintPRO 4 is suitable for filtering emissions for up to four LC Magna printers or four Air Wash L washing stations or a combination of the two.
